“An emoji-spilling, hashtag streaming visual prose-poem. There’s a force in the linguistic landscape of the Internet these days that is insistent and commanding and sometimes aggressive, an intensity perfectly captured in #whatev’s exquisite tableaux and uncanny hashtag poetry. A work of Internet pageantry.” – Cheryl Simon
